欢迎光临高碑店顾永莎网络有限公司司官网!
全国咨询热线:13406928662
当前位置: 首页 > 新闻动态

gccgo导入非标准库包:正确姿势与实践

时间:2025-11-28 21:55:22

gccgo导入非标准库包:正确姿势与实践
这可以区分真正的浮点数和可以转换为整数的字符串。
同时,我们也强调了输入验证、时区考虑以及使用DateTime对象进行更高级日期操作的重要性,这些都是构建健壮、可靠应用程序不可或缺的部分。
下面通过完整示例展示如何使用reflect包调用普通函数和结构体方法。
inside: 如果设置为 true,标签将显示在饼图扇区内部。
核心方案是放弃传统的jQuery AJAX请求,转而采用XMLHttpRequest,并将其responseType设置为blob,从而正确处理服务器返回的二进制PDF数据,并在客户端触发文件下载,确保用户能够顺利获取受保护的PDF文件。
从 C++11 开始,推荐使用 using 来替代 typedef。
例如: 立即学习“go语言免费学习笔记(深入)”; type Person struct {   Name string   Age int } func updateAge(p Person) {   p.Age = 30 } person := Person{Name: "Alice", Age: 25} updateAge(person) fmt.Println(person.Age) // 输出 25,原值未变 因为 updateAge 接收的是 person 的副本,函数内部修改不影响原始变量。
6. 最终解决方案与注意事项 根据日志分析和配置检查结果,采取相应的措施: 完全禁用Xdebug(当不需要时): 将xdebug.mode设置为off。
然而,在实现策略解析器时,一个常见的陷阱是引入服务定位器(Service Locator)模式。
为了防止阻塞,可以添加default分支,实现非阻塞式操作。
这种差异可能导致跨平台问题。
开发者应始终遵循最新的最佳实践,利用context.WithTimeout等功能,为外部HTTP请求配置合理的超时时间,从而构建健壮、高效的云应用。
_self_ 关键字: 确保当前配置文件中 defaults 列表以外的其他顶级键也被加载到最终配置中。
不过,有几个小细节值得注意: 类型选择: 如果你的数字可能包含小数,那就用float()。
import os from pathlib import Path file_name = "example.txt" # 假设这个文件存在 if os.path.exists(file_name): size_bytes = os.path.getsize(file_name) print(f"文件 '{file_name}' 的大小是 {size_bytes} 字节。
只要遵循命名和目录结构约定,就能轻松运行测试。
检查 SQL 语句是否正确,并确保列名和值正确。
使用标准库手动校验 最基础的方式是通过 net/http 获取表单数据,并逐项判断是否符合要求。
组织验证(OV): 除了验证域名所有权外,还需要验证你的组织信息。
- **调整PHP配置:** 虽然不是首选,但在某些极端情况下,你可能需要临时调高 `memory_limit`。

本文链接:http://www.douglasjamesguitar.com/988820_8110fb.html